Preventive Measures
Preventive measures are critical to safe health. These
measures aim to reduce the risk of illnesses and injuries, thereby preventing
the need for medical treatment or intervention. Examples of preventive measures
include:
Vaccinations: Vaccinations are a safe besides effective way
to protect against infectious diseases such as measles, mumps, rubella, and
polio. Vaccinations have significantly reduced the prevalence of these diseases
in many parts of the world.
Hygiene: Maintaining good hygiene practices can help prevent
the spread of infections. Simple measures such as washing hands regularly,
covering the mouth and nose while coughing or sneezing, and avoiding close
contact with sick people can significantly reduce the risk of infections.
Healthy diet: An extreme diet rich in fruits, vegetables,
whole grains, and lean proteins and low in processed foods and sugars can help
maintain a substantial weight and reduce the risk of chronic diseases such as
diabetes, heart disease, and certain cancers.
Exercise: Regular exercise can help maintain a healthy
weight, improve cardiovascular health, reduce stress, and improve mood. Aim for
at least 150 activities of moderate-intensity exercise per week.
Medical Treatment
In addition to preventive measures, safe health involves
seeking appropriate medical treatment. Medical treatment can help diagnose and
treat illnesses, manage chronic conditions, and prevent complications. Following
recommended treatment plans and taking medications as healthcare providers
prescribe is essential. Examples of medical treatments include:
Medications: Medications can help treat various health
conditions such as infections, high blood pressure, diabetes, and depression.
It is essential to take medications as prescribed and to inform healthcare
providers of any side effects or adverse reactions.
Surgery: Surgery is often necessary to treat conditions like
cancer, heart disease, and injuries. Discussing the risks and benefits of
surgery with healthcare providers and following post-operative care
instructions carefully is essential.
Rehabilitation: Rehabilitation is essential for individuals
recovering from injuries or surgeries. Physical, occupational, and speech
therapy can help individuals regain mobility, strength, and independence.

Ethical fashion refers to the production and consumption of
clothing and accessories that are made in a socially and environmentally
responsible manner. The fashion industry is known for its negative impact on
the environment and labor practices. Ethical fashion seeks to address these
issues by promoting sustainability, fair labor practices, and transparency in
the supply chain.
Sustainability
Sustainability is a core principle of ethical fashion. The
fashion occupational is one of the largest polluters in the world, with
significant environmental impacts at every stage of the production process.
Ethical manner seeks to reduce these impacts by promoting sustainable practices
such as:
Using eco-friendly materials: Ethical fashion brands use organic
cotton, linen, and hemp without harmful pesticides and chemicals. They also use
recycled materials such as plastic bottles, recycled polyester, and repurposed
fabrics to reduce waste.
Recycling and upcycling: Ethical fashion brands promote
recycling and upcycling by creating new garments and accessories from old
clothes and materials. This reduces the amount of waste going to landfills and
conserves resources.
